The following illustration shows A, B, and BD, used to calculate the bend deduction: The following equation is … WebK Factor in sheet metal bending is a constant used to calculate sheet metal flat length or Flat-pattern. Mathematically k factor value is equal to the ratio of position of neutral axis and sheet thickness. During sheet metal part bending, the inside bending surface is compressed, whereas the outer surface is stretched. Neutral Axis Representation.

WebMay 7, 2024 · K-factor, bend allowance, and bend deduction are important values used to calculate the correct sheet metal flat length or flat pattern. The length of the sheet in the bending state is different from the length of the flat pattern because the sheet metal will stretch and compress during bending on the press brake..
